From the Meeting Point at Bowens Landing to the Water

The tour departs from Gansett Cruises at 2 Bowens Landing in Newport. This convenient location puts you right at the heart of the harbor area. After arriving, guests board a vintage lobster boat that’s been beautifully restored to offer both comfort and character.

The boat comfortably accommodates up to 49 travelers, ensuring a relaxed atmosphere without feeling crowded. The ticket redemption point is at 30 Market Square, making it easy to pick up tickets and start your water adventure. The meeting point and ticketing process are straightforward, and confirmation is received instantly at booking.

The Route Highlights: Fort Adams and Coastal Views

Morning Mimosa Cruise with Gansett Cruises in Newport, RI - The Route Highlights: Fort Adams and Coastal Views

The main water stop features a view of Fort Adams, a significant military site with a compelling history. The guide explains the fort’s original purpose—to protect Newport from foreign threats—and details its transformation into a state park today.

As the boat cruises past, passengers can enjoy sweeping vistas of the harbor, yachts, and historic waterfront. The scenic backdrop provides ample opportunities for photos, especially during clear weather, which is frequently noted in reviews. The informative commentary enhances the experience, making the scenery come alive with stories of local history, architecture, and maritime life.

Practical Tips and Booking Details

Morning Mimosa Cruise with Gansett Cruises in Newport, RI - Practical Tips and Booking Details

The tour lasts around 75 minutes, making it a light but satisfying outing. It’s recommended to book at least two weeks in advance due to its popularity. The minimum age requirement is flexible, as most travelers are welcomed, including families with children.

Cancellation is free up to 24 hours in advance, providing peace of mind in case of weather concerns or scheduling conflicts. The tour requires good weather; if canceled due to poor conditions, guests are offered another date or a full refund.
